Ticket #—: SpokeShift rebalancer miscounts docked bikes after midnight rollover. Affects the nightly truck-routing plan for the Carverton zone. Likely a timezone handling bug in the snapshot job. As the new contractor, start by reproducing locally with the sample feed in the repo. The failing build is identified by the token directly below.

pipeline stamp: htk4_ae36

- [ ] Step 7: Archive cold storage buckets (Glacierline tier). Confirm both ceremony witnesses are present, verify bucket manifests match the Oxbow ledger, then seal the archive key shares. Plugin authors may observe but not handle shares. Once sealed, the archive index itself is encrypted and can only be reopened with the passphrase below.

vault phrase of badup-hahig = tamael-aldael-kelmir-istael-fenok-istwyn-tamius-jorath-oliion

Handover note — Crumbwheel order cutoffs.

Welcome aboard. The bakery cutoff rule in Crumbwheel closes same-day orders at 14:00 local to each storefront, not UTC — this has bitten us twice. Holiday overrides live in the calendar service and take precedence silently, so always check there first when a cutoff looks wrong. To unlock the calendar service's admin console after a restart, enter the recovery passphrase below.

vault phrase of bagap-bahaf = silion-pelox-sorox-casdor-quenwyn-fraax-eliox-praael-kelion-quenvan-kasox-rusael-norius-belvan

Hi team, as I rotate off, here is what future maintainers need for shipping the PinPoint widget. Releases go out every second Thursday. Run the suggestion-accuracy suite against the Varrowton fixture set first, then bump the version in the manifest and regenerate the minified bundle. Verify the debounce timing hasn't regressed; past releases broke on slow connections. CDN upload requires the signed bundle, and the gatekeeper job will reject anything unsigned. Deploys are authenticated with the key below.

release key, hadug-kawef: bky13_mPGeFZeR1GZ1G

Subject: DR drill — Graphwright

Team,

DR drill for Graphwright, our dependency graph visualizer, runs Thursday 0900. We fail over to the Kelden Ridge cluster, verify graph rendering from cold storage, then fail back. Release manager owns the go/no-go call at each step. No deploys during the window. Restore of the config vault requires manual unlock; the passphrase you'll need is below.

vault phrase of tawig-taduf = zorath-oliwyn